aliyun / aliyun-openapi-php-sdk

[Abandoned] Open API SDK for PHP developers
Other
606 stars 806 forks source link

第一次的请求有什么用处,注释了也正常执行 #37

Closed laodaxyz closed 6 years ago

laodaxyz commented 7 years ago

1,2017-09-22 01:53:54: url: http://location.aliyuncs.com/?Id=cn-shanghai&ServiceCode=live&Type=openAPI&RegionId=cn-hangzhou&AccessKeyId=.*&Format=JSON&SignatureMethod=HMAC-SHA1&SignatureVersion=1.0&SignatureNonce=.*&Timestamp=2017-09-22T01%3A53%3A54Z&Action=DescribeEndpoints&Version=2015-06-12&Signature=ip.*

2,2017-09-22 01:53:54: url: http://live.aliyuncs.com/: postFields: {"DomainName":"livetest.hefantv.com","RegionId":"cn-shanghai","AccessKeyId":".","Format":"JSON","SignatureMethod":"HMAC-SHA1","SignatureVersion":"1.0","SignatureNonce":".","Timestamp":"2017-09-22T01:53:54Z","Action":"DescribeLiveMixConfig","Version":"2016-11-01","Signature":".*"}

在核心包httpHelper写了日志

第一次的请求有什么用处,注释了也正常执行?

conan425 commented 6 years ago

@laodaxyz 这是SDK中自动寻址的逻辑,由于每个产品线在各个区域的域名可能是不一样的,所以SDK要先通过RegionId去寻找域名然后并缓存起来,在缓存有效期内只执行一次,谢谢您的关注。